  2. To continue (some activity or life in general) as best as one can. "Keeping" is often colloquially shortened to "keepin'." A: "Hey, Mike, how you doing?" B: "Not bad, homie. Just keepin' on keepin' on." You've got to just keep on keeping on, no matter how trying the work may get.

  4. Feb 16, 2024 · The phrase "keeping on keeping on" essentially means to continue doing what you're doing, especially when it's challenging or when progress is slow. It's often used to encourage someone to keep going and not lose heart, even when the going gets tough.
